In sound deadening restoration, a methodical approach is key. The process begins by thoroughly evaluating the structure and its unique characteristics. This involves understanding the materials used in construction, as well as any existing noise sources or points of entry. For instance, in older buildings with wooden frameworks, identifying and sealing gaps and cracks is crucial to prevent sound transmission. Conversely, in modern structures with concrete walls and steel frames, techniques like adding mass through specialized panels or using acoustic insulators can significantly enhance sound deadening.

A well-structured plan ensures that every aspect of the restoration is addressed effectively. This includes both physical modifications and aesthetic considerations.
